What Does a Life Insurance Agent in Eaton Rapids Cost?

A term life insurance policy for a healthy 35-year-old in Michigan typically costs between $20 and $40 per month for a 20-year 500000 dollar policy. Whole life insurance premiums are higher often starting at 100 dollars per month for the same coverage amount. Final expense policies for seniors may range from 30 to 70 dollars per month. Costs vary by age health and policy features. This is general information and not insurance advice.

What license does a life insurance agent in Eaton Rapids need?
Michigan requires life insurance agents to hold a valid resident or non-resident license issued by the Michigan Department of Insurance and Financial Services. Agents must complete continuing education courses to renew their license every two years.
How do Michigan laws affect life insurance payouts?
Michigan has a two-year contestability period during which an insurer can deny a claim for misrepresentation. After two years the policy is generally incontestable. Michigan also requires prompt payment of claims typically within 30 days of receiving proof of death.
